Personalized Gifts: Unique, meaningful items like engraved watches, custom jewelry, or a heartfelt letter
On your wedding day, the gift you choose for your fiancé should reflect the depth of your love and the uniqueness of your bond. Personalized gifts stand out because they carry a piece of your shared story, making them unforgettable. Unlike generic presents, these items are tailored to your partner’s personality, interests, or your relationship milestones, ensuring they resonate on a deeper level. For instance, an engraved watch with the date of your first meeting or a custom necklace with coordinates of where you got engaged transforms a simple accessory into a cherished keepsake.
When selecting a personalized gift, consider the emotional weight it will carry. A heartfelt letter, handwritten on high-quality paper and sealed with wax, can be a timeless choice. It allows you to express feelings that might be difficult to articulate in person, creating a tangible reminder of your love that can be revisited for years. Pair it with a small, symbolic item like a locket or a leather-bound journal to elevate its significance. The key is to make it personal—reference inside jokes, shared dreams, or pivotal moments in your relationship to ensure it feels uniquely yours.
Custom jewelry is another powerful option, especially when designed with thoughtfulness. For example, a bracelet engraved with a meaningful phrase or a ring incorporating their birthstone adds a layer of intimacy. If your fiancé isn’t a jewelry wearer, consider personalized accessories like a leather wallet, cufflinks, or a key chain with a significant date or initials. The goal is to create something they’ll use or wear regularly, serving as a constant reminder of your connection.
Practicality and sentimentality can coexist beautifully in personalized gifts. For instance, a custom-made sketch of your wedding venue or a framed map of the place you first said “I love you” combines artistry with nostalgia. Alternatively, a curated playlist of songs that hold special meaning, engraved on a wooden USB drive, offers a modern twist on a traditional gift. These items not only celebrate your past but also become part of your future together.
Finally, remember that the best personalized gifts are those that feel authentic to your relationship. Avoid overcomplicating the process—sometimes, simplicity speaks volumes. Whether it’s a watch, a piece of jewelry, or a letter, the effort and thought behind the gift will shine through. By focusing on what makes your bond unique, you’ll create a wedding day present that’s as extraordinary as your love.

Sentimental Keepsakes: Photo albums, framed vows, or a time capsule of memories together
On your wedding day, the gift you choose for your fiancé should reflect the depth of your love and the journey you’ve shared. Sentimental keepsakes like photo albums, framed vows, or a time capsule of memories together are timeless choices that encapsulate your story. These gifts aren’t just objects; they’re tangible reminders of the moments that have shaped your relationship, offering comfort, joy, and a sense of continuity as you step into a new chapter of life.
A photo album is more than a collection of images—it’s a curated narrative of your relationship. Start by selecting photos that highlight key milestones: your first date, vacations, and candid moments that reveal your connection. Include captions or handwritten notes to add context and emotion. For a modern twist, consider a lay-flat album with high-quality paper that allows photos to span across pages, creating a visually immersive experience. If time is tight, delegate the task to a trusted friend or family member who knows your story well. The result? A gift that becomes a cherished ritual, flipped through on anniversaries or quiet evenings, reigniting the spark of your early days.
Framed vows transform words into art, turning the promises you make at the altar into a daily reminder of your commitment. Choose a frame that complements your home decor—perhaps a rustic wooden frame for a cozy feel or a sleek metal one for a modern touch. Pair the vows with a background that holds meaning, such as a map of where you met or a floral design from your wedding bouquet. Hang it in a shared space like the bedroom or living room, where it can serve as a silent witness to your love. This gift not only honors the significance of your wedding day but also reinforces the values and intentions you’ve pledged to uphold.
A time capsule of memories is a forward-thinking keepsake that captures your past while anticipating your future. Gather items that symbolize your relationship: ticket stubs from your first concert together, a playlist of your favorite songs, or a letter each of you writes to your future selves. Include predictions or hopes for your life together—where you’ll travel, how you’ll grow, or what traditions you’ll start. Set a date to open it, such as your 10th anniversary, and make it a ritual. This gift is a promise to revisit your roots, celebrate your progress, and dream anew. Practical tip: Use a durable, airtight container to protect the contents, and store it in a place that’s both accessible and meaningful, like a closet in your first home together.
Each of these keepsakes offers a unique way to honor your relationship, but they share a common purpose: to preserve the essence of your love in a form that endures. Whether you choose the visual storytelling of a photo album, the daily inspiration of framed vows, or the anticipatory joy of a time capsule, you’re creating a legacy that transcends the wedding day itself. These gifts aren’t just for your fiancé—they’re for the both of you, a shared treasure that grows in meaning with each passing year.

Luxury Experiences: Spa day, romantic getaway, or a surprise adventure for post-wedding relaxation
Your wedding day is a whirlwind of emotions, vows, and celebration, but what comes after is just as important. Gifting your fiancé a luxury experience for post-wedding relaxation isn’t just a present—it’s an investment in your shared future. Consider a spa day, a romantic getaway, or a surprise adventure as a way to unwind, reconnect, and celebrate your new chapter together.
A spa day is the epitome of indulgence, offering a sanctuary of calm after the chaos of wedding planning. Opt for a couples’ package that includes massages, facials, and access to thermal baths. For maximum impact, choose a spa with unique treatments like sound therapy or gemstone rituals. Pro tip: Book a private suite for added intimacy and extend the experience with a champagne toast afterward. This isn’t just pampering—it’s a ritual of renewal, a reminder to prioritize each other’s well-being in the years ahead.
If you’re craving more than a day, a romantic getaway is the ultimate escape. Think beyond the typical beach resort; consider a secluded villa in Tuscany, a private island in the Maldives, or a cozy cabin in the Swiss Alps. Tailor the destination to your shared passions—wine tasting, hiking, or simply lounging in luxury. To make it unforgettable, arrange for personalized touches like a private chef, a sunset cruise, or a stargazing session. This isn’t just a vacation; it’s a chance to create memories that will anchor your marriage in joy and adventure.
For the couple that thrives on spontaneity, a surprise adventure is the perfect gift. Keep the details under wraps until the last moment—a helicopter tour over a city, a hot air balloon ride at dawn, or a guided safari. The key is to align the activity with your partner’s interests while pushing boundaries slightly. For instance, if they’ve always wanted to try scuba diving, pair it with a stay at an overwater bungalow. This approach combines the thrill of the unknown with the comfort of knowing it’s tailored to them.
Each of these experiences serves a dual purpose: they celebrate your love and provide a buffer between the intensity of your wedding and the rhythm of married life. Whether you choose the serenity of a spa, the intimacy of a getaway, or the excitement of an adventure, the goal is the same—to start your marriage with a shared moment of luxury, relaxation, and connection. After all, the best gifts aren’t things; they’re experiences that become the foundation of your story together.

Practical Presents: High-quality luggage, personalized robe, or a stylish accessory for the honeymoon
Choosing a wedding day gift for your fiancé that balances sentimentality with practicality can be a thoughtful way to celebrate your union. One standout idea is to focus on items that enhance your honeymoon experience, ensuring the gift is both meaningful and immediately useful. High-quality luggage, a personalized robe, or a stylish accessory can elevate the trip while symbolizing the start of your shared adventures. These gifts not only serve a purpose but also carry the weight of your thoughtfulness, making them memorable long after the honeymoon ends.
High-quality luggage is a gift that keeps on giving, especially for couples who love to travel. Opt for a durable, lightweight suitcase with a sleek design that reflects your fiancé’s style. Brands like Away or Rimowa offer options with built-in chargers or customizable features, adding a modern twist. Consider monogramming the luggage with their initials or your wedding date for a personal touch. This gift not only ensures they travel in style but also becomes a tangible reminder of your wedding day every time you embark on a new journey together.
A personalized robe is another practical yet luxurious gift, perfect for lounging during lazy honeymoon mornings or spa days. Choose a plush, high-quality fabric like Turkish cotton or silk, and embroider their name, initials, or a sweet nickname. Pair it with matching slippers or a set of monogrammed towels for a complete self-care package. This gift not only provides comfort but also adds a touch of elegance to their daily routine, making them feel pampered and cherished.
For a more fashion-forward approach, a stylish accessory tailored to your honeymoon destination can be a winning choice. If you’re heading to a tropical beach, a designer sun hat or polarized sunglasses could be ideal. For a city escape, a leather crossbody bag or a sleek watch might suit their style. The key is to select something that complements their wardrobe while being functional for the trip. This gift not only enhances their honeymoon look but also becomes a versatile piece they’ll use long after the trip ends.
When selecting any of these gifts, consider the balance between practicality and personalization. A high-quality item that aligns with their tastes and needs will always be appreciated. Adding a personal touch, whether through monogramming, customization, or thoughtful selection, ensures the gift feels uniquely theirs. Ultimately, these practical presents not only serve a purpose during your honeymoon but also become cherished keepsakes that celebrate the beginning of your married life together.

Future-Focused Gifts: Joint journal, couple’s cookbook, or a symbolic plant to grow together
On your wedding day, the gift you choose for your fiancé should reflect not just the love you share today, but the life you’re building together. Future-focused gifts like a joint journal, a couples cookbook, or a symbolic plant to grow together embody this sentiment, offering tangible ways to nurture your relationship as it evolves. These gifts aren’t just tokens of affection; they’re tools for creating shared experiences, memories, and growth.
A joint journal serves as a living record of your journey, capturing moments, dreams, and reflections along the way. Start by selecting a journal that feels meaningful—perhaps one with a cover that symbolizes your relationship or pages made from sustainable materials. Establish a routine: dedicate 10 minutes each week to write individually, then share your entries with each other. Include prompts like “What’s one thing I’m grateful for this week?” or “What’s a goal we’re working toward together?” Over time, this journal becomes a chronicle of your partnership, a testament to how you’ve grown individually and as a couple. Pro tip: Include mementos like ticket stubs, photos, or pressed flowers to make it even more personal.
If you’re a duo that bonds over food, a couples cookbook is a practical yet romantic choice. Begin by curating recipes that hold special meaning—the dish from your first date, a family favorite, or a meal you’ve always wanted to try together. Organize the book into sections like “Weeknight Dinners,” “Date Night Delights,” and “Holiday Traditions.” As you cook together, annotate the pages with notes about how you adapted the recipe or memories of the meal. This gift not only strengthens your culinary skills but also creates a ritual of cooking and sharing meals, a cornerstone of a loving home. Bonus: Include a section for “Future Favorites” to add recipes as you discover them.
For a gift that literally grows with your relationship, consider a symbolic plant. Choose a species that reflects your journey—a resilient succulent for enduring love, a flowering plant for blossoming together, or a tree sapling for long-term growth. Involve your fiancé in the care process by creating a shared responsibility chart for watering, pruning, and repotting. Pair the plant with a plaque or tag engraved with your wedding date and a meaningful quote. As the plant thrives, it becomes a daily reminder of the effort and care you both invest in your relationship. Practical tip: Research the plant’s needs beforehand to ensure it thrives in your environment.
Each of these gifts—the joint journal, couples cookbook, and symbolic plant—offers a unique way to invest in your future together. They’re not just presents for the wedding day but ongoing projects that deepen your connection. By choosing one (or all) of these, you’re not just celebrating your love today; you’re actively shaping the life you’ll build tomorrow.
